Hey teens, I have something to tell you and it may not be something you want to hear. Sorry about that in advance. But actually what I have to say is good for everyone to hear, because I’m sure the misconceptions about online privacy don’t end just with your age group.

Even apps that promise they “destroy” your message or photo seconds or minutes after it’s sent can’t protect someone taking a screenshot or photo of the screen that has the message or photo displayed. There is no technology available today in 2019 that can stop me from taking a photo of my phone’s screen. I have now easily defeated any app’s promise that things will disappear forever. They won’t. Don’t fall for the marketing.
Why This is Directed at TeensI feel like teens, more than most adults, are especially unaware of the dangers of forgetting about their privacy or taking it for granted. They take for granted and often feel like their friend today will be their friend two or three years from now. They don’t always appreciate or understand how others can perhaps innocently share something with someone outside their friend group, and before you know it, it’s being passed along indiscriminately online.
